What Syntopia is, what it costs, and where it stands as of August 12, 2026.
Syntopia is an AI avatar live-commerce platform — a TikTok Shop–first system for brands that want a virtual presenter selling products on livestream. It is operated by Hifetch Ltd, a UK legal entity, alongside a sister agency, LiveBuzz Studio. Pricing runs from Mini at $29/mo (90 streaming minutes) through Starter at $380/mo (60 hours), Pro at $760/mo (120 hours), and Business at $2,580/mo (unlimited), with custom Enterprise terms (including Dual Live Stream) and a $1,380 one-time custom avatar. That works out to roughly $6.33 (Starter/Pro tiers; Mini is ~$19.33/hr) per streaming hour.

The single biggest difference between the two platforms, walked through fairly.
Syntopia's content model is a script-unit and Q&A library, with LLM responses off by default. On its own that's a defensible safety choice — but in practice it means the presenter can't handle a question it hasn't been pre-loaded for. Syntopia's native AI-extract (PDF to Q&A) returned zero usable pairs in testing, which is why its power users author scripts in Claude and bulk-import them through Excel.
TwinTone is LLM-first by default: the host reads chat and answers in seconds, grounded in your actual site content. For live commerce, that means prices, stock levels, and product facts are available at speak time as tool calls — the host can quote a real price or flag an out-of-stock item mid-conversation instead of reading a stale script.
